    <description>Modvat credit was treated as available on inputs covered by an endorsed bill of entry, because the six-month restriction in Rule 57G(5) was said to apply to documents that are issued in the relevant sense, and not to a bill of entry. The endorsed bill of entry stood in the assessee&#039;s name within six months, the first lot of goods was received within that period, and credit was taken on that basis. For later lots received piecemeal, credit was deferred until actual receipt of the goods, so the timing of those entries did not make the claim time-barred. The denial of credit was therefore considered unjustified.</description>
